js或jq判断输入的字符串和数组的包含关系

JavaScript012

js或jq判断输入的字符串和数组的包含关系,第1张

var flag = false

var str = 'wweabc'

for(var i=0 i<arr.length i++){

    if(str.indexOf(arr[i])!=-1)

        flag = true

}

if(flag)

    console.log('包含')

js 代码是支持很多String 类的方法的,建议你可以用indexOf 来判断一个字符串是否存在于另一个字符串中,示例:

判断aaa 是否存在于 123aaa456 中

'aaa'.indexOf('123aaa456')

如果返回值不等于-1 说明存在。